  • The safety of guests and associates is our number one priority at Topgolf. To ensure everyone has a fun and safe experience, it's important to follow these rules.

    • Never cross the red line - whenever someone else is taking their shot, stay behind the red line at all times.
    • Keep Back from the Edge - for your safety, please avoid standing too close to the edge of the bay on the upper levels.
    • Don't Aim for the Buggy - to avoid the possibility of causing injury to our drivers, never aim a shot at our buggies on the range.
    • Don't Step onto the Range - remember that golf balls can cause serious injury, so always stay within the bay.
    • Never Lean Over Bay Dividers - to avoid injury, avoid leaning on the dividers between each bay at all times.
    • No Running Starts - running on the build up to your shot is dangerous. All shots should be taken from a static position.
    • Under 16s Must be Supervised - any member under the age of 16 must be supervised by an adult at all times as a condition of play.
    • Never jump or push others into the safety nets - it is extremely dangerous to jump, or push others into the safety nets.

    IMPORTANT: We have a zero tolerance for breach of our safety rules. A breach of our safety rules may, in our sole discretion, result in termination of play, termination of your ability to play at a Topgolf in the future and claims for damages and compensation.

How does Topgolf know which ball is yours? ›

A Monza RAIN RFID tag chip embedded inside the ball is read, associated with the player and activated for play. Players hit the balls at target greens which are holes in the ground that, much like a dart board, are divided into sub-targets that make up different scoring zones.

What is the highest score you can get in golf? ›

Rules of Handicapping FAQs

If you have an established Handicap Index®, the maximum score for each hole played is limited to a net double bogey, equal to double bogey plus any handicap strokes you are entitled to receive based on your Course Handicap™.

How do you score the best ball in golf? ›

In best ball, each player plays their own ball throughout the round, and the lowest score on each hole is used as the team score. For example, if player A makes a birdie, player B makes a par, player C makes a bogey, and player D makes a double bogey, the team score is a birdie.
